Technical Specifications

  • Memory Type: DDR2 SDRAM
  • Module Capacity: 1GB
  • Rank: 1Rx8 (single rank)
  • Speed: PC2-5300F (667MHz)
  • Voltage: 1.8V
  • Form Factor: 240-pin DIMM
  • CAS Latency: CL5
  • Timing: 5-5-5-15
  • Operating Temperature: 0 to 85 deg C
  • ECC Support: Not applicable (non-ECC)
